Eid-el Kabir: Agency Warns Residents Against Reckless Waste Disposal

Bauchi State Environmental Protection Agency (BASEPA) has warned residents against reckless disposal of animal excrement in waterways during the upcoming Eid-el Kabir celebrations.

The director-general of the agency, Dr Kabir Ibrahim disclosed this in Bauchi during an interaction with community leaders and butchers.

He said the agency will not take it lightly with anyone who violates the order, adding designated waste collection centers were demarcated.

The director-general represented by the director Inspection, Enforcement and Compliance, Muhammad Usman Saleh warned Muslim Ummah in the State not to dispose of the slaughtered animals wastes in drainages, waterways and open spaces.

The director further said the agency will evacuate all waste disposed at its designated collection centers to keep the environment tidy.

He also warned against flaming of animal parts such as, heads, legs and skin using particles that will generate smoke in residential areas and to ensure they carry out the processings in places to be provided by the ward heads, adding that whoever is found going against the directives will be punished accordingly.

The director-general also used the forum to wish the Muslim Ummah across the globe a happy Eid celebration in advance.

Responding, the chairman of Butchers Association of Nigeria in Bauchi local government branch, Ibrahim Musa promised total compliance.
